    This role sits at the intersection of creative operations, marketing technology, automation and digital activation. You will lead the technical activation and delivery of dynamic creative campaigns across multiple platforms and channels at ArtBot.

    You will work closely with media teams, strategists, analysts, creatives,developers and platform partners to build, activate and optimise personalized advertising experiences for some of the world’s leading brands. As a senior member of the department, you will also help mentor and support junior team members, driving operational best practice and helping evolve the team’s technical capabilities. The ideal candidate is highly organised, technically curious and excited by the evolving landscape of creative technology, automation and AI-assisted workflows.

    The Creative Activation team sits at the centre of campaign execution, creative technology and operational excellence at ArtBot. The team is responsible for activating and scaling dynamic creative campaigns across multiple digital platforms, ensuring campaigns are delivered accurately, efficiently and with performance in mind.

    You will: 

    Campaign Activation & Delivery.

    Lead the activation and delivery of dynamic creative campaigns across display, video, social, CTV, retail media and emerging channels
    Configure and manage campaign setups across various ad servers, social channels, creative management platforms and proprietary systems
    Manage large scale creative variations, data feeds and audience driven messaging frameworks
    Ensure campaigns are delivered accurately, efficiently and to a consistently high standard

    Creative Technology & Automation.

    Identify opportunities to improve operational workflows through automation and scalable processes
    Support the development and implementation of workflow optimisation initiatives
    Collaborate with product and development teams to improve activation tools, templates and systems
    Contribute to the adoption of AI-assisted workflows and emerging creative technologies where appropriate

    Quality Assurance & Troubleshooting.

    Maintain a strong “right first time” approach to campaign activation and QA
    Troubleshoot technical issues across creative builds, feeds, platforms and campaign delivery environments
    Develop and maintain activation documentation, processes and best practices

    Team Leadership & Collaboration.

    Mentor and support junior team members
    Foster a collaborative, solutions focused team culture
    Work cross functionally with accounts, strategy, analytics, creative and development teams to deliver integrated campaign solutions

    Client & Stakeholder Partnership.

    Act as a trusted technical and operational lead for key clients and internal stakeholders
    Communicate complex technical conc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ical audiences
    Support ongoing innovation, experimentation and performance optimisation initiatives

    You have: 

    3+ years’ experience in activation, ad operations, campaign management, creative operations or marketing technology
    Strong understanding of the digital advertising ecosystem, including programmatic, social and video platforms
    Experience within DCO alongside creative management platforms, ad servers or DSPs
    Strong organisational and project management skills with the ability to manage multiple campaigns and stakeholders simultaneously
    Comfortable working with structured data, campaign feeds and large-scale creative variations
    Excellent troubleshooting and problem-solving skills
    Strong attention to detail and commitment to operational excellence
    Experience mentoring or supporting junior team members
    Confident communication skills across both technical and non-technical audiences
    Curiosity around automation, emerging technologies and AI-assisted workflows

    Advantageous

    Knowledge of HTML5, CSS and JavaScript
    Experience with APIs, feed-based workflows or workflow automation tools
    Familiarity with creative production pipelines and scalable content operations
    Experience working across display, OLV, CTV, retail media or commerce media channels
    Understanding of audience segmentation, tagging and personalisation frameworks
    Experience collaborating with product, engineering or platform development teams
